Dr. james nathan ford Source Source Source Source Source Source Source Source Source Source Read Also: Nathan scott ford Nathan ford beauxartsbath.co.uk Nathan ford artist Nathan ford Beaux arts bath nathan ford Nathan ford beauxartbath.co.uk